Closed Bug 626587 Opened 14 years ago Closed 14 years ago

XPI file is uploaded with localized name / cannot download uploaded XPI file if the addon has a localized name

Categories

(addons.mozilla.org Graveyard :: Developer Pages, defect, P2)

x86
Linux
defect

Tracking

(Not tracked)

VERIFIED FIXED
5.12.7

People

(Reporter: yuki, Assigned: jbalogh)

References

Details

Attachments

(3 files)

When I uploaded an XPI file for a new version of my addon, it is unexpectedly uploaded with the localized name. Moreover, when I clicked the link to the XPI file, it said "404 File Not Found". This problem appears with following conditions: * I access to AMO's localized page (e.g. https://addons.mozilla.org/ja/developers/addons ) * The addon has localized name. For example, the addon "Informational Tab" ( https://addons.mozilla.org/ja/firefox/addon/informational-tab/ ) has two names: "Informational Tab" for en-US "情報化タブ (Informational Tab)" for ja Then, the uploaded file is renamed to "情報化タブ_informational_tab-XXXX-fx.xpi", and there is a download link to https://addons.mozilla.org/_files/4930/%E6%83%85%E5%A0%B1%E5%8C%96%E3%82%BF%E3%83%96_informational_tab-XXXX-fx.xpi but it is 404.
Attached image screenshot: the link
Uploading in en-US should work around this for now.
Target Milestone: --- → 5.12.7
This appears to be an issue somewhere between Apache and the file system, so unicode file names are on the way out. The file exists with the name we expect but it can't be accessed through Apache. Even if we debugged this on our servers, we'd have to deal with the same issues on the release mirrors.
Assignee: nobody → jbalogh
Priority: -- → P2
Status: NEW → RESOLVED
Closed: 14 years ago
Resolution: --- → FIXED
The conclusion was to stop allowing UTF-8 in file names since we can't guarantee the configuration of our release mirrors. Add-on names and slugs are still allowed UTF-8. thanks jeff
Filed bug 628787 about the vague error message. Add-ons with unicode in their file name fail upload. Checked that unicode is still allowed in add-on names and slugs @ https://addons.allizom.org/en-US/firefox/addon/%E3%82%A2%E3%83%89%E3%82%AA%E3%83%B3%E3%82%92%E3%83%96%E3%83%A9%E3%82%A6%E3%82%BA/
Status: RESOLVED → VERIFIED
Attached image post-fix screenshot
Product: addons.mozilla.org → addons.mozilla.org Graveyard
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: